Our client, a boutique Finance House based in Birmingham are seeking an exceptionally organised and discreet Executive Assistant to provide comprehensive support to the Chief Risk Officer for a boutique Finance House. This is a pivotal role requiring the highest levels of professionalism, discretion and initiative, supporting a senior executive in a fast-paced environment.

The successful candidate will act as the primary point of contact for the Chief Risk Officer, managing complex diary commitments, coordinating high-level meetings, and facilitating seamless communication both internally and with external stakeholders. There will also be support to two other Executives including Legal Counsel. You will be responsible for maintaining the efficiency of the executive office whilst demonstrating impeccable attention to detail and anticipating needs before they arise.

The role will entail:

  • You will maintain meticulous diaries to ensure smooth planning of the executive's meeting commitments, coordinating administrative and travel time as required.
  • Comprehensive coordination of meetings, including arranging facilities, organising catering requirements, and preparing supporting paperwork such as agendas, handouts and minutes.
  • You will assist with executive reporting, ensuring deadlines are strictly adhered to, and organise complex travel arrangements taking all transport options into consideration whilst producing informative itineraries.
  • Provide high-quality secretarial services including occasional minute taking at relevant meetings.
  • The role also encompasses handling any other ad hoc requests from the Executive Team with flexibility and professionalism.

Applicants will have previous PA experience and a real passion and drive to be an Executive Level right hand person. Strong communication skills, attention to detail and a natural sense of drive and a service driven this are key.
